Re: [Ubnt_users] Rocket M2 ethernet link problem.

2017-11-07 Thread Steve Barnes
Was the new radio setup in the office or was it an on-site setup?  Could be bad 
radio. Water in the line, cable not plugged in well at top.  No matter what I 
would expect a climb.  Setup a new one in office and make sure it is good. 
Climb swap it first see what you get.  Re-terminate. And rerun if nothing else. 
 Any spare cables?

Jay, It sounds like you've done everything except test the cable end to end 
with a good tester which is the first thing I'd do. After that, I'd swap out 
the RM2.

On Mon, Nov 6, 2017 at 8:36 PM, Jay Weekley 
> wrote:
We lost a Ubiquiti Rocket M2 during a storm. We replaced it with a "new"
out of box M2 but it won't link with the 10/100/1000 switch. When the
techs bypass the switch they get a 10 megabit link but not 100 megabit
and can access the radio on their laptop but moving the radio back to
the switch and nothing. For trouble shooting they tried the following
but nothing gave them a link to the switch:
- swapping the switch with another 10/100/1000 unit.
- swapping patch cords
- replacing the power supply.
- forcing the radio to 10 megabit full.
- resetting and reprogramming the radio.
- re-terminating the lower end of the cable run.
Is this a cable issue? It's a 2 month old Shireen Cat 6 run so I hate to
think it's bad already. The weather isn't going to make another tower
climb likely for the next few days so we need to get it to link with the
switch for a little while. Any suggestions on how to do that? Find an
old 10/100 switch?
